Content | The colloquium presents contemporary studies on the relevance for the social and related sciences. We will present theoretical, qualitative, and quantitative studies, and we will endeavor to also feature new methodological approaches. We focus on studies relating to local and global social structures, change, and transitions relating to the individual and society. Speakers are invited to demystify the research process by presenting research in process, "warts and all". |
Learning objectives | Participants will - expand their competences in assessing scientific work and research - learn how to critique scientific work constructively - be exposed to multidisciplinary and transdisciplinary research - expand their knowledge horizon about empirical social research - be encouraged to take more risks in developing a research design and research agenda |
Bibliography | Recommended preparatory reading: Crouch, C. (2016). Society and social change in 21st century Europe. Pelgrave. Goldin, I. (2016). The pursuit of development. Economic growth, social change, and ideas. Oxford University Press. |
